The street in brief

Spring Vale Heights is almost entirely detached houses. The median sale price is £234,995, about 71% above the typical BB3 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£2,534, above the district's £1,554.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; BB3 prices as a whole have been rising. With 13 sales across 13 homes since 2024, the street turns over frequently.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
